Import Xiaomi phones? There may be a problem.

Posted on September 11, 2021 by William

For many years, Xiaomi has turned a blind eye to this, even though it has explicitly prohibited doing so in certain areas of the company. Terms and conditions. However, now, reports keep popping up (via XDA-Developer) The company is changing its position. Users in Cuba, Iran, Syria, North Korea, Sudan, and Crimea reported that their mobile phones were remotely disabled by Xiaomi, with a message explaining why:

Xiaomi’s policy does not allow the product to be sold or offered in the region where you are trying to activate the product. Please contact the retailer directly for more information.

If you see this message, your imported Xiaomi phone is essentially a soft brick.
